The 104-year-old Shimla Ice Skating Rink, one of Asia's oldest and a historic landmark of Himachal Pradesh, is the ultimate destination for ice skating enthusiasts. Located in the heart of Shimla, this iconic rink has become a symbol of the city’s colonial heritage and remains a favorite winter attraction. The skating season began earlier than usual this year, thanks to favorable weather conditions and clear skies, offering early opportunities for skating enthusiasts to glide across Asia's largest natural ice skating rink.
A Glimpse into the History of Shimla's Ice Skating Rink
The Shimla Ice Skating Rink dates back to 1920, originally serving as a tennis court before it was transformed into a natural ice skating rink. The idea came from an Irish military officer, Blessington, who noticed that the water he sprinkled on the tennis court to settle the grass would freeze instantly during the winter months. Inspired by this, he decided to convert the area into an ice skating rink, which has since become a cherished part of Shimla’s winter tradition.
Spanning the size of five tennis courts (58x30 meters), the rink is a significant attraction not only for its skating opportunities but also for its cultural value. Surrounded by the scenic views of Shimla’s hills, it offers an enchanting experience that continues to captivate visitors year after year.

Challenges and the Future of Shimla Ice Skating Rink
While the Shimla Ice Skating Rink holds historical and cultural significance, it faces challenges, particularly outdated infrastructure and a lack of government support. The rink’s management, along with local communities, hopes to revive its former glory with much-needed investments and improvements. With proper support, the Shimla Ice Skating Rink has the potential to remain a premier destination for winter sports enthusiasts and continue drawing tourists from around the world.
